Opening Statement of Chairman Ro Khanna: Hearing on “Toxic Air: How Leaded Aviation Fuel Is Poisoning America’s Children”
In a July 2022 congressional hearing, Chairman Ro Khanna highlighted the health dangers of leaded aviation fuel (Avgas) still used in small general aviation aircraft, noting that children near airports in communities of color face blood lead levels exceeding those seen during the Flint water crisis. The statement criticizes the FAA and EPA for failing to act urgently on phasing out leaded fuel, despite the existence of viable unleaded alternatives, and accuses oil companies and aviation industry groups of deliberately delaying the transition. Khanna calls on federal agencies to accelerate approval of lead-free fuel options, involve affected communities in decision-making, and use infrastructure funding to support the switch to unleaded aviation fuel. -

Leaded aviation gasoline exposure risk at Reid-Hillview Airport in Santa Clara County, California
This 2021 report by Mountain Data Group, commissioned by Santa Clara County, examines the health risks posed to children living near Reid-Hillview Airport in California due to lead emissions from leaded aviation gasoline. It analyzes statistical associations between children's blood lead levels and factors such as residential distance from the airport, aircraft traffic, and fuel sales. Model-extrapolated estimates of airborne lead concentrations at U.S. airports
This EPA technical report estimates airborne lead concentrations near U.S. airports caused by piston-engine aircraft burning leaded aviation gasoline (avgas). Using air quality modeling and extrapolation methods, the study identifies airports where lead levels may exceed national air quality standards, particularly in areas close to aircraft run-up zones. While not specific to Sea-Tac Airport, the findings are relevant to understanding aviation-related air quality impacts at airports nationwide. -
